Transaction 51a8f5a4b33f9d4b4e24a6892063de40c84fbdff0ead893c8d43671922a65b1e

1 Input
2 Outputs
  • 51a8f5a4b33f9d4b4e24a6892063de40c84fbdff0ead893c8d43671922a65b1e:0
  • value  1151844
    address  17YkPsUdimWTF6RrPgKzAstdQcdkdvXbBN
  • 51a8f5a4b33f9d4b4e24a6892063de40c84fbdff0ead893c8d43671922a65b1e:1
  • value  5144186
    address  34JScT5P3eKZN83sFTJCgtDgbXYHR5y2ub